.Bopis{border-bottom:2px solid #a6a6a6;padding-bottom:25px;padding-top:18px;position:relative;z-index:99}.Bopis.removeBottomBorder{border-bottom:none}.Bopis .delivery,.Bopis .inStorePickUp{display:flex;flex-direction:row;line-height:16px}.Bopis .delivery.notAvailable,.Bopis .inStorePickUp.notAvailable{color:rgba(0,0,0,.5)}.Bopis .delivery.notAvailable .inStorePickUpImg,.Bopis .delivery.notAvailable .pickUpMessage,.Bopis .inStorePickUp.notAvailable .inStorePickUpImg,.Bopis .inStorePickUp.notAvailable .pickUpMessage{opacity:.5}.Bopis .delivery.notAvailable .inStoreUnavailableIcon,.Bopis .inStorePickUp.notAvailable .inStoreUnavailableIcon{cursor:pointer;height:12px;margin-top:1.5px;width:12px}.Bopis .delivery.notAvailable .storeName,.Bopis .inStorePickUp.notAvailable .storeName{color:inherit;cursor:inherit;font-family:SamsungOne400;font-size:12px;letter-spacing:0;line-height:14px;pointer-events:none}.Bopis .delivery .deliveryDetails,.Bopis .delivery .inStorePickUpDetails,.Bopis .inStorePickUp .deliveryDetails,.Bopis .inStorePickUp .inStorePickUpDetails{display:inline-block;flex-direction:column;margin:0 10px}.Bopis .delivery .deliveryLabel,.Bopis .delivery .inStorePickUpLabel,.Bopis .inStorePickUp .deliveryLabel,.Bopis .inStorePickUp .inStorePickUpLabel{font-family:SamsungOne700;font-weight:400;letter-spacing:0}@media (max-width:768px){.Bopis .delivery .deliveryLabel,.Bopis .delivery .inStorePickUpLabel,.Bopis .inStorePickUp .deliveryLabel,.Bopis .inStorePickUp .inStorePickUpLabel{font-size:13px}}@media (min-width:769px){.Bopis .delivery .deliveryLabel,.Bopis .delivery .inStorePickUpLabel,.Bopis .inStorePickUp .deliveryLabel,.Bopis .inStorePickUp .inStorePickUpLabel{font-size:13px}}.Bopis .delivery .storeName,.Bopis .inStorePickUp .storeName{color:#4297ff;cursor:pointer;font-family:SamsungOne700;font-size:13px;letter-spacing:0;line-height:16px;margin-left:10px}.Bopis .delivery .pickUpMessage,.Bopis .inStorePickUp .pickUpMessage{color:#4a4a4a;font-family:SamsungOne400;font-size:12px;letter-spacing:0;line-height:14px}.Bopis .delivery .pickUpLimitedQtyMessage,.Bopis .inStorePickUp .pickUpLimitedQtyMessage{color:#fc8c6b;font-family:SamsungOne700;font-size:12px;letter-spacing:0;line-height:14px}.Bopis .tooltip{position:relative}.Bopis .tooltip .tooltipText{background:#fff;border:1px solid #4a4a4a;bottom:50%;box-sizing:"border-box";color:#000;font-family:SamsungOne400;font-size:11px;line-height:22px;padding:11px 8px;position:absolute;right:-50px;width:180px;z-index:1}.Bopis .delivery{margin-top:15px;position:relative}.Bopis .delivery .overlay{background-color:#fff;border-radius:11px;box-shadow:0 2px 4px 0 rgba(0,0,0,.24);left:6%;min-height:183px;position:absolute;width:87%}@media (max-width:768px){.Bopis .delivery .overlay{left:8%;width:86%}}.Bopis .delivery .overlay .content{padding:15px}@media (max-width:768px){.Bopis .delivery .overlay .content{padding:10px}}.Bopis .delivery .overlay .content .inputSection{border-bottom:.5px solid #979797;padding:5px 0;position:relative}.Bopis .delivery .overlay .content .inputSection input{border:none;color:#636363;font-family:SamsungOne400;font-size:14px;height:23px;letter-spacing:.13px;line-height:17px;margin-left:20px;text-align:justify;width:75%}.Bopis .delivery .overlay .content .inputSection input:focus{outline:none!important}.Bopis .delivery .overlay .content .inputSection input.noDelivery{color:#ff4339}.Bopis .delivery .overlay .content .inputSection .button{background-color:#4297ff;border-radius:27.5px;color:#fff;font-family:SamsungOne700;font-size:12px;height:25px;letter-spacing:0;line-height:25px;max-width:40px;min-width:40px;padding:0;position:absolute;right:0;text-align:center;top:3px}.Bopis .delivery .overlay .content .inputSection .button.disableContinue{background-color:#a6a6a6;color:#fff;pointer-events:none}.Bopis .delivery .overlay .content .inputSection .navigationIcon{height:18px;position:absolute;top:5px}.Bopis .delivery .overlay .content .inputSection p.errorMsg{color:red;font-family:SamsungOne400;font-weight:400;letter-spacing:normal;margin:5px 0}@media (max-width:768px){.Bopis .delivery .overlay .content .inputSection p.errorMsg{font-size:12px}}@media (min-width:769px){.Bopis .delivery .overlay .content .inputSection p.errorMsg{font-size:14px}}.Bopis .delivery .overlay .content .deliveryType{color:#000;font-family:SamsungOne700;font-size:12px;letter-spacing:.32px;line-height:14px;margin:10px 0}.Bopis .delivery .overlay .content .deliverySlots{font-family:SamsungOne400;font-size:11px;letter-spacing:0;line-height:13px}.Bopis .delivery .overlay #cover-spin{background-color:hsla(0,0%,100%,.7);border-radius:11px;bottom:0;left:0;position:absolute;right:0;top:0;width:100%;z-index:9999}@-webkit-keyframes spin{0%{-webkit-transform:rotate(0deg)}to{-webkit-transform:rotate(1turn)}}@keyframes sp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.Bopis .delivery .overlay #cover-spin:after{-webkit-animation:spin .8s linear infinite;animation:spin .8s linear infinite;border:4px solid #000;border-radius:50%;border-top-color:transparent;content:"";display:block;height:40px;left:48%;position:absolute;top:40%;width:40px}.Bopis .delivery .overlay .noDelivaryForZip{color:#ff4339;font-family:SamsungOne400;font-size:10px;letter-spacing:0;line-height:12px;margin:25px;text-align:center}.Bopis .inStorePickUpImg{height:17px;width:18px}.Bopis .deliveryImg{height:15px;width:18px}.Bopis+div:not(.otherDiscounts)+.horizontalBorder{border:none!important}.Bopis .overlay-wrapper .dialog.box{height:100%;overflow:hidden;width:100%!important}.Bopis .overlay-wrapper .content>div{height:100%}@media (max-width:768px){.Bopis .overlay-wrapper .close{right:20px}}.Bopis .overlay-wrapper .close:after,.Bopis .overlay-wrapper .close:before{height:60px!important}#iframe-store-container,#iframe-store-wrapper{height:100%}#iframe-store-container #iframe-loader,#iframe-store-wrapper #iframe-loader{height:100%;width:100%}.google-map-pin{height:20px!important;width:16px!important}.google-map-pin .circle{fill:#fff}